Types of Tears
- Tears aren't just for crying; there are three types: basal, irritant, and emotional.
- Basal tears, produced by the lacrimal gland, keep eyes moist and clean.
Purpose of Irritant Tears
- Irritant tears protect our eyes from environmental threats.
- These tears are produced in larger quantities than basal tears and contain lysozyme, an antibacterial enzyme.
